Use a hair dryer or prepare an iOpener and apply it to the lower edge of the iPod for about a minute in order to soften up the adhesive underneath.
-
The bottom of the screen (near the home button) is held in place with strong adhesive.
-
As you start prying the screen off in the next stages, you may need to apply more heat to keep the glue warm and flexible.
